China organic-rich shale geologic features and special shale gas production issues

The depositional environment of organic-rich shale and the related tectonic evolution in China are rather different from those in North America. In China, organic-rich shale is not only deposited in marine environment, but also in non-marine environment: marine-continental transitional environment and lacustrine environment. Through analyzing large amount of outcrops and well cores, the geologic fea-tures of organic-rich shale, including mineral composition, organic matter richness and type, and li-thology stratigraphy, were analyzed, indicating very special characteristics. Meanwhile, the more complex and active tectonic movements in China lead to strong deformation and erosion of organic-rich shale, well-development of fractures and faults, and higher thermal maturity and serious heterogeneity. Co-existence of shale gas, tight sand gas, and coal bed methane (CBM) proposes a new topic:whether it is possible to co-produce these gases to reduce cost. Based on the geologic features, the primary pro-duction issues of shale gas in China were discussed with suggestions.
